Factoring (Invoice Discounting)

Industry: Importing/ Wholesaling – Fresh Flowers

Business Stage: Start up

Funding: $1,250,000

Background

  • A business was started with the acquisition of cool rooms, initial stock and the payment of a rental bond for premises
  • The purchaser’s available funds were depleted in the acquisition process, leaving insufficient working capital to begin trading
  • Any banks approached for support declined to provide assistance on the basis that they would only consider lending after the business had an established track record

Hermes Solution

Hermes established a Factoring Facility for the business to receive up to 80% of the value of its sales in the week they were invoiced.

Outcome

The business was able to finance importation and delivery of goods to launch the new enterprise and fund the on-going growth of the business in its initial start-up phase.
